Resource towns in the Mackenzie Basin / Robert M. Bone.

Title: Resource towns in the Mackenzie Basin / Robert M. Bone.
Author(s): Bone, Robert M.
Date: 1998.
In: Cahiers de Géographie du Québec. (1998.), Vol. 42(116) (1998)
Abstract: Resources towns defined as those established to house labour force necessary to exploit resource in remote area. Paper examines these towns from perspective of changes in their population size. Two of communities studied are in Northwest Territories: Pine Point and Norman Wells.
